I just had to use Stroke of Genius to fill in the canvas!! I used the two tiny little blotches with lots of Memento ink to fill it in. I used the new Spotted Cutting Plate to emboss the background kraft panel. To do this I used the following sandwich in my Big Shot: Multipurpose Platform on tab 1, plastic cutting plate, Spotted Cutting Plate die side up, cardstock, Spellbinders embossing mat, plastic cutting plate.

My second project is a wall hanging I made using the super fun Wood Pallet wall hanging available in the TE Store. I painted it with white acrylic paint thinned with water so it has a white washed look. I added black paper for a chalkboard look and then die cut the word CREATE using the Chunky Alpha. Under that I stamped a sentiment from A Life She Loved. The clusters of flowers in the corner are a combination of Cherish Every Moment, Friendship Blooms Dies, Bloom Where You Are Planted Dies, Mini Leaves dies, All A Flutter Overlay dies and Silhouette Stems 4.
